WebApr 15, 2024 · Boston Globe photographer John Tlumacki shot some of the most dramatic images of the bombings, including the iconic photograph of three Boston Police … WebAn inclination of 100%. It should be noted that a slope of 100% is not vertical, but it is equivalent to having an identical height and width, which results in a 45° angle of inclination. For example: a mountain path with a 100% gradient would rise 100 meters for every 100 meters it goes forward. The distance along this slope would be 141.4 ...

WebA satelliteis said to occupy an inclined orbitaround Earthif the orbitexhibits an angle other than 0° to the equatorial plane. This angle is called the orbit's inclination. A planet is said to have an inclined orbit around the Sunif it has an angle other than 0° to the eclipticplane. Types of inclined orbits[edit] Geosynchronous orbits[edit]

WebThe orbit of one object can be measured by an angle relative to another plane, called the inclination. The other plane is called the reference plane. The measurement of inclination is an angle.
